The problem is that not all gummies are created equal. The effectiveness of Vitamin D gummies depends on several factors, including the dosage, the form of Vitamin D (D2 vs. D3), and individual absorption rates.
Many gummies contain Vitamin D2 (ergocalciferol), which is less effective at raising blood levels of Vitamin D than Vitamin D3 (cholecalciferol). Studies have shown that Vitamin D3 is more readily absorbed and utilized by the body. Therefore, if you’re relying on gummies, make sure they contain Vitamin D3.
Dosage is another critical factor. The recommended daily allowance (RDA) of Vitamin D is 600 IU for adults, but some individuals may require higher doses, especially if they are deficient. Many gummies contain only a fraction of the RDA, meaning you might need to consume several gummies to reach the recommended intake.
But even with the right form and dosage, absorption can be an issue. Factors like age, weight, and gastrointestinal health can all affect how well your body absorbs Vitamin D from supplements. Individuals with digestive disorders, such as Crohn’s disease or celiac disease, may have difficulty absorbing Vitamin D, regardless of the source.

What can Dallas residents do to combat this potential deficiency? The answer lies in a multi-pronged approach that combines strategic sun exposure, effective supplementation, and regular monitoring.
First, maximize your sun exposure during off-peak hours. Aim for 15-20 minutes of sun exposure on your arms and legs between 10 AM and 3 PM, but avoid prolonged exposure that could lead to sunburn. Consider taking a walk during your lunch break in a park or open area, away from tall buildings.
Second, choose a Vitamin D3 supplement with an appropriate dosage. Consult with your doctor to determine the right dosage for your individual needs. Consider taking a liquid or softgel form of Vitamin D3, as these are often better absorbed than gummies.
Third, get your Vitamin D levels checked regularly. A simple blood test can determine if you’re deficient and help you adjust your supplementation accordingly. Aim for a blood level of 30-50 ng/mL.
Fourth, consider dietary sources of Vitamin D. Fatty fish, such as salmon and tuna, are excellent sources of Vitamin D. Fortified foods, such as milk and cereal, can also contribute to your daily intake.
